Kubernetes-Erweiterungsklassen

  • Freigeben Version: Zurich
  • Aktualisiert 31. Juli 2025
  • 1 Minute Lesedauer
  • Die App „Discovery and Service Mapping“ fügt Klassen für das Kubernetes-Muster hinzu oder aktualisiert sie.

    Die CMDB CI-Klassenmodelle App fügt Klassenmodelle hinzu, die erweitern CMDB Klassenhierarchie, einschließlich Klassenbeschreibungen, Identifizierungsregeln, Bezeichnereinträge und falls zutreffend, abhängige Beziehungen. Sie können die hinzugefügten Klassen wie jede andere verwenden CMDB Klasse. Anwendungen wie Muster für Discovery und Service-Mapping Kann die Klassenerweiterungen verwenden, um CIs auszufüllen und Technologien und Software zu erkennen.

    Sie finden vollständige Versionshinweise für alle CMDB CI-Klassenmodelle Releases um:

    Apps im Store anfordern

    Besuchen Sie die ServiceNow Store-Website, um alle verfügbaren Apps anzuzeigen und Informationen zum Senden von Anforderungen an den Store zu erhalten. Kumulative Informationen zum Release für alle veröffentlichten Apps finden Sie in den Release-Hinweisen zum ServiceNow Store-Versionsverlauf.

    Kubernetes-Muster

    Der Haupt-Flow des Kubernetes-Musters hilft bei der Erkennung von Kubernetes-Kernelementen. Die Klassen in diesem Release erweitern die Unterstützung, um Kubernetes-Arbeitsauslastungs-Controller-Komponenten wie Bereitstellungen, Daemonsets und statefulSets zu erkennen. Die Bibliothek für die Arbeitsauslastungsfreigabe erfasst Informationen zu Bereitstellungen, Daemonsets und Statefulsets und speichert sie in den entsprechenden Tabellen. Andere Erweiterungen umfassen eine YAML- und Service Mesh-Erweiterung, die eine YAML-Datei generiert, um Konfigurationsdateien nachzuverfolgen und Service-zu-Service-Beziehungen durch Erkennung von Service-Mesh-Informationen zu erstellen.

    Abbildung : 1. Kubernetes-Erweiterungsklasse, die in integriert ist CMDB Hierarchie
    Kubernetes-Erweiterungsklasse, die in integriert ist CMDB Hierarchie.
    Abbildung : 2. Kubernetes-Arbeitsauslastung
    Kubernetes-Arbeitsauslastung.

    Klassen

    In diesem Abschnitt werden die Klassen aufgeführt, die die CMDB CI-Klassenmodelle Store-App fügt hinzu oder aktualisiert sie.

    CMDB CI-Klassenmodelle: Release 1.12.0 fügt die folgenden Klassen für das Kubernetes-Muster hinzu. Für die Liste der Klassen in Basissystem, Einschließlich Klassen, die diese App erweitern könnte, siehe CMDB-Tabellenbeschreibungen.

    Klasse Erweitert Felder Beziehung
    cmdb_ci_kubernetes_workload cmdb_ci_kubernetes_components Stellt von cmdb_ci_kubernetes_Service bereit
    cmdb_ci_kubernetes_deployment cmdb_ci_kubernetes_workload
    • Replikate Gewünscht
    • Replikate Aktualisiert
    • Replikate Gesamt
    • Replikate Verfügbar
    • Replikate Nicht Verfügbar
    Auf Cluster gehostet
    cmdb_ci_kubernetes_daemonset cmdb_ci_kubernetes_workload
    • Ausgeführte Pods
    • Pods Warten
    • Pods Erfolgreich
    • Pods Fehlgeschlagen
    • Pods Verfügbar
    Auf Cluster gehostet
    cmdb_ci_kubernetes_statefulset cmdb_ci_kubernetes_workload
    • Ausgeführte Pods
    • Pods Warten
    • Pods Erfolgreich
    • Pods Fehlgeschlagen
    • Pods Verfügbar
    Auf Cluster gehostet